WebIncorporation by Reference. The method of making one document of any kind become a part of another separate document by alluding to the former in the latter and declaring … In law, incorporation by reference is the act of including a second document within another document by only mentioning the second document. This act, if properly done, makes the entire second document a part of the main document. Incorporation by reference is often found in laws, regulations, contracts, legal and regulated documentation. WebMar 14, 2024 · An in-text citation is an acknowledgement you include in your text whenever you quote or paraphrase a source. It usually gives the author’s last name, the year of publication, and the page number of the relevant text. The … WebFeb 21, 2024 · Description The includes () method compares searchElement to elements of the array using the SameValueZero algorithm. Values of zero are all considered to be equal, regardless of sign. (That is, -0 is equal to 0 ), but false is not considered to be the same as 0. NaN can be correctly searched for.

WebReference list entries should be alphabetized by the last name of the first author of each work. For multiple articles by the same author, or authors listed in the same order, list the entries in chronological order, from earliest to most recent.
